With the growing number of international travel, trade, and cultural exchange, the need to understand temperature conversions has increased. The US is one of the few countries that still uses Fahrenheit as its primary temperature scale, while most of the world uses Celsius. This discrepancy can lead to confusion and miscommunication, especially when dealing with people from other countries or when accessing international weather forecasts.
